Mobile Phone Donation Tips
Text-in donations and donations through QR codes have become common practices. QR codes and the Square Card Reader provide an electronic way for people to give on the spot, and may eliminate middlemen expenses. To make an informed decision before donating through cell phones, donors should be aware of the following:
- Giving through Text:
- The amount and frequency of donations may be capped by wireless carriers during times of high-giving (such as after a natural disaster).
- Wireless carriers may not transfer funds until you pay your bill.
- Find out if normal texting rates apply to your donation.
- Commit only to an amount you can afford. If you intend to donate one-time only, follow the appropriate instructions for a one-time donation and review your phone bills to protect against recurring unauthorized charges.
- Giving through QR Code and the Square Card Reader:
- Anyone can create a QR code or buy a Square Card Reader. Be very careful that the code you scan was provided by a charity and that the person facilitating your Square transaction is authorized by the charity to receive donations on its behalf.
- With QR codes, double check the corresponding website to ensure that you are linked correctly.
- Always check your receipt and your credit card/PayPal statement to ensure the transaction charged to your account is accurate.
